Message type: E = Error
Message class: ER - IS-U regional structure
Message number: 064
Message text: Allocation to voltage level &1 already maintained

- Allocation to voltage level &1 already maintained ?The SAP error message ER064, which states "Allocation to voltage level &1 already maintained," typically occurs in the context of SAP IS-U (Industry Solution for Utilities) when there is an attempt to allocate a resource or a service to a voltage level that has already been assigned or maintained in the system.
Cause:
- Duplicate Allocation: The primary cause of this error is that there is already an existing allocation for the specified voltage level in the system. This could happen if a user tries to create a new allocation without first checking if one already exists.
- Data Integrity Issues: There may be issues with data integrity where the system does not allow multiple allocations to the same voltage level to prevent conflicts or inconsistencies in the data.
- Configuration Errors: Sometimes, configuration settings in the SAP system may lead to this error if they are not set up correctly.
Solution:
- Check Existing Allocations: Before attempting to create a new allocation, check the existing allocations for the specified voltage level. You can do this by navigating to the relevant transaction or report that lists allocations.
- Modify Existing Allocation: If an allocation already exists and needs to be updated, consider modifying the existing entry instead of creating a new one.
- Delete Duplicate Entries: If you find that there are duplicate entries that should not exist, you may need to delete the unnecessary ones. Ensure that you have the proper authorizations and that you follow your organization's data management policies.
- Consult Documentation: Review the SAP documentation or help files related to the specific module you are working with to understand the constraints and requirements for allocations.
- Contact Support: If you are unable to resolve the issue, consider reaching out to your SAP support team or consulting with SAP support for further assistance.
